*Deep pain in buttox ("sit bone") *Hips feel like they are in a vise grip by late afternoon *numbness elbow to pinky finger *heel pain *Some excersize helps but is difficult to do *Trouble sleeping *Fatigue *feeling of wanting to slouch all the time *brain fog comes and goes *pain radiates down back of leg from buttox

here's my list: -low back pain -joint pain diffuse -radiating pain from hips to ankles -joint stiffness increased in AM -burning mouth syndrome -endometriosis -fatigue -swollen ankles -swollen submandibular glands -red eyes on and off -trigger points throughout body -new this year: difficulty breathing due to decrease chest expansion -h/o plantar fasciitis -severe reflux in past requiring surgery -h/o kidney stones -h/o vulvodynia I believe most of these are related. Diagnosed with undifferentiated spondolopathy.
* low back pain (severe at times) * buttock pain (severe at times) and goes down the back of my legs * significant decrease range of motion * fatigue (severe at times) * sternal pain * stiffness after sitting or laying down * difficulty sleeping because of pain * feel like someone's pushing on my back (really have to be conscience of my posture) * left shoulder and left knee pain * occasional plantar faciitis
